The theory, technology, and application of terahertz metamaterial biosensors: A review
Terahertz metamaterial biosensors combine terahertz time-domain spectroscopy with metamaterial sensing to provide a sensitive detection platform for a variety of targets, including biological molecules, proteins, cells, and viruses.

This work presents a dual‐band photodetector based on the large‐scale, precise synthesis of Cs2AgBiBr6 single crystals. A rapid and efficient synthesis method is demonstrated, yielding high‐quality Cs2AgBiBr6 crystals with an average size of 2 × 2 × 1.5 mm3 and a production yield of 12.66%.
